Subject: Expansion — Norvale Region

Team,

We're moving on Norvale. Sales leads: expect territory assignments by Friday. First office opens in Tarnmouth; staffing handled by Bree Olmsted. Targets are aggressive but achievable given Keldra Systems' weak coverage there. No external comms until launch day. Budget questions go to Finn Arbuckle. Hold all recruitment chatter until the announcement clears. The confidential rationale for timing is set out directly below.

internal memo for bajep-yajeg: The steering committee signed off on a budget of $152.1 million for Project Ulaius.

Handover Note — Pilot with Bramford Retail Group

To the heads of department: the Veltrix shelf-analytics pilot moves from my remit to Director Halloway's as of Monday. Store rollout in the Norcliffe region is at six of ten sites, with feedback due end of month. All vendor correspondence is archived in the shared drive. The confidential line below covers what comes next commercially.

board note of fafof-yagap: Aldiusek Partners plans to raise the Kelius list price by 44.3 percent in December. The steering committee signed off on a budget of $193.7 million for Project Fenael. The renewal with Lamoxax Freight closes at $366.4 million a year, 20.7 percent below the last contract. Project Sormir slips by a full year because of the staffing delay.

# Artifact Signing — Payments Retry Module

Quick note for security review: the Quillpay retry module now embeds idempotency keys in each signed request bundle, so duplicate charges can't sneak through on replay. We sign the bundle at build time and verify at the gateway. Verification happens against the key below:

rollout seal: bky4_x7Gc

## 2.9.0 — Changed defaults

Shelfhound catalogue import now defaults to incremental mode. Full re-imports require an explicit flag. Batch size dropped from 5000 to 1000 records to stop the MARC parser from starving the queue worker. Duplicate-detection is on by default; dedupe failures now skip rather than abort. If imports stall, verify the running config matches the values below.

settings of tagef-bawif:
DRUIX_HOST=druix.zemvarlabs.internal
DRUIX_PORT=8000